Cause and effect structure is a type of writing that shows how one event or situation (the cause) leads to another event or situation (the effect). This type of structure is often used in essays, articles, and reports to explain how things happen.
There are a number of words and phrases that can be used to signal cause-and-effect relationships in writing.
These include:
BecauseSinceSoThereforeThusHenceConsequentlyAs a resultFor this reason
These words and phrases can be used to help the reader understand the relationship between cause and effect.
